设为首页收藏labplus社区产品资料库
1454
积分值+2
601
掌控币+1
0  关注
74  粉丝
263  帖子

#物联网应用#Sense HAT和掌控互动-2-遥控掌控灯


【写在前面】

仔细想下,我玩的这个项目没有实际意义。

树莓300+,Sense Hat 200+,遥控了掌控板+扩展板200+。

如果有,就是探索意义,教育意义,好在我还能用来写其它的帖子,所以成本也近乎于0 。

如果能让别的老师从中有点启发,写出别的项目,就有收获了。

对我来说,就是玩板子。变出花样玩板子。

我只做基础的探索,复杂的应用项目大家来做吧。

当然后期可以遥控掌控板做出的其它各种设备了。

【树莓派传感器扩展板】

该产品是树莓派官方推出、专为Astro Pi 所设计的扩展板(Astro Pi是ESA与Raspberry Pi基金会合作的一个教育项目),命名为Pi Sense Hat。该扩展板附加在树莓派顶部,通过GPIO引脚(提供数据和电源接口)与树莓派组成一个“Astro Pi”。

该扩展板集成了一个8 8的RGB LED矩阵、一个五向摇杆以及一些传感器:

陀螺仪

加速度计

磁强计

气压计

温度传感器

湿度传感器


【器材准备】

树莓派3B以上版本 1

goodway树莓镜像1.3以上

掌控板版本不限 1

Sense HAT 1


【目标】

用Sense 的摇杆来遥控掌控板的灯显示不同的光及关掉。

向上  红灯

向下  蓝灯

向左  黄灯

向右  绿灯

按下  关灯

【项目分析】

树莓和掌控都通过WIFI接入GDW IOT,树莓经IOT向掌控发送字符消息,掌控接收到消息并执行相应动作。

【视频展示】


【项目实现】

1、登录平台

树莓上电开机(树莓要接入WIFI)

电脑登录http://www.gdwrobot.cn/,进入软件平台,登录帐号,连接树莓。

2、写树莓端发送程序

从物联网中找到如下积木


从智能硬件中找到如下积木


2.1写测试程序如下:

认识一下Sense 摇杆调试输出值


2.2 测试程序如下,加上IOT

服务器和端口号默认

这个服务器搭建在云端,树莓通过互联网接入

帐号密码可以不填

本项目设备/主题 zhuxianwei/hat



运行程序,查看由IOT发来的输出完全正确


3、掌控程序如下

用mPythonX或者mPython



刷入掌控板,测试。

【小问题】

如果你有设备,后面计划做些什么项目呢?


4

点赞

597 次阅读3 条评论4 人赞
3条评论